Juventus are ready to step up their interest in PSG midfielder Adrien Rabiot, who has also attracted interest from Arsenal and Chelsea. The 19-year old has come up through the ranks at the French club and he has just one year left on his contract, although he is reluctant to sign a new deal.

He started 12 Ligue 1 games last season but wants more first-team action, which he could find very hard to get in Paris. Roma and Inter are also keen on a move for the youngster but it’s Serie A champions Juventus who are in pole position to sign Rabiot.

They are set to step up their interest in the coming weeks and reports from Italy are claiming that Juve are willing to offer Stephan Lichtsteiner as part of the deal but PSG are believed to just want a cash-only package as part of any move for the midfielder.
